AI-powered tools aren’t just another layer of technology to add to your workflow. They can transform the way marketers and content creators work, speeding up processes with more precision and foresight.
Here’s how AI content creation tools can transform your work:
High-quality content often involves significant investments in time and personnel, whether it’s for market research, script writing, or platform optimizations. Traditional content production requires a team of marketing professionals (or one very exhausted content creator) who need compensation for their time. AI tools automate labor-intensive tasks, freeing up valuable resources.
From brainstorming ideas to editing and revising, it’s easy for behind-the-scenes logistics to weigh creators down. AI content management tools can schedule posts, generate subtitles or closed captions, and correctly format content for different platforms. With these lengthy processes automated, creators can produce content at scale while saving energy for more strategic work, boosting overall content quality.
One of the biggest barriers for content creators? Cracking the algorithm. Simply creating great content isn’t enough because it has to rank well in social media algorithms and search engines.
AI-powered tools can help identify high-ranking keywords, analyze competitor content, and predict which topics are most likely to perform well. This data-driven approach helps creators and marketers fine-tune their process and create content that resonates with both their target audiences and the algorithms.

Whether you need help capturing the ideation process, generating images, or filling in for a writer, here are five great AI-powered tools:
Otter is an all-in-one AI meeting assistant capable of automatically taking meeting notes, summarizing insights, capturing action items, and automating follow-up — and then some. On top of this, you can use Otter AI Chat to generate content based on your meetings from a blog post based on a meeting discussion to a social media calendar based on all of your meetings across an entire year - Otter whips them up based on your meetings. It’s a valuable tool for streamlining AI content planning and turning meetings into actionable content ideas and creation. You can even record your ideas on the go!

Perhaps the most well-known AI content creation tool on the internet, ChatGPT is a generative AI tool that can help with writing and brainstorming. From drafting blog posts and generating social media content to answering customer queries and brainstorming content strategy, ChatGPT is designed to mimic human-like text.

Canva is an AI-powered image generator that allows users to create professional-looking visual content, including social media posts, infographics, and event flyers. It’s useful for content creators who produce video or written content and need to generate engaging visual elements.

Similar to ChatGPT, Copy.ai is a natural language processing tool designed specifically for marketers. It generates written content for blogs, social media, or product descriptions — whatever your needs are. Its biggest advantage is the ability to analyze interviews and sales calls and turn them into written content, maintaining the voice and tone of the original recording.

Synthesia is an AI-powered video creation app that creates realistic videos and avatars from text prompts and video scripts. For content creators who work in sales, training, or reporting, it’s a useful tool to create professional-quality video content.
